camp shell-init

Output shell initialization code

Synopsis

Output shell initialization code for your shell config.

Add to your shell config: zsh: eval "$(camp shell-init zsh)" bash: eval "$(camp shell-init bash)" fish: camp shell-init fish | source

This provides:

  • cgo function for navigation
  • Tab completion for camp commands
  • Category shortcuts (p, c, f, etc.)

The cgo function enables quick navigation: cgo Interactive picker or jump to campaign root cgo p Jump to projects/ cgo p api Fuzzy find "api" in projects/ cgo -c p ls Run "ls" in projects/ directory

camp shell-init <shell> [flags]

Examples

  # Add to ~/.zshrc
  eval "$(camp shell-init zsh)"

  # Add to ~/.bashrc
  eval "$(camp shell-init bash)"

  # Add to ~/.config/fish/config.fish
  camp shell-init fish | source
